Handing this one over — the great Pipegrove descriptor hunt. Short version: the ingest workers slowly leak file descriptors and fall over after roughly four days. I've ruled out the HTTP client and narrowed it to the archive-extraction path; something isn't closing handles when extraction fails mid-file. There's a repro script in the tooling repo and lsof snapshots from last week's incident. New folks, please read the investigation log before poking at it — everything's on the page below.

runbook for badug-kadup: https://confluence.zemvarlabs.internal/projects/browse/display/projects/bd1b

## Fan-out backpressure (Heronpipe)

If notification fan-out lags, check queue depth on the relay tier first — anything over 50k means consumers are falling behind. Bump consumer replicas before touching batch size; batch tweaks have bitten us twice. If senders are still getting 429s after ten minutes, enable shed mode to drop low-priority digests. Full escalation steps and the shed-mode toggle walkthrough are documented here:

operations page: https://jenkins.zemvarcloud.local/job/merge_requests/repo/build/73930b4b30f0a8ed

Subject: Handover — Ledgerline flaky tests

Taking over from me before the eng sync: the Ledgerline payments integration tests still flake on the settlement fixture, roughly one run in five. Root cause looks like stale snapshots in the test database, not app code. I've scheduled a nightly reset job. If you need to inspect the fixture data directly, use the connection string below.

primary connection of yagep-kahip = redis://giliel_svc:zYiKsLL2PLpfPL@db-348f.xolmarsys.corp:5432/fenwyn

# Ordersvc environments — soft deletes

Ordersvc uses soft deletes on the orders table in all environments: rows get a deleted-at timestamp and are excluded by the default query scope. Hard purges run weekly in production only; staging retains everything for replay testing. On-call: if a customer reports a vanished order, check the deleted-at column before escalating. Each environment's purge and retention behaviour follows the settings below.

service settings:
ZORWYN_HOST=zorwyn.tolvaqsys.internal
ZORWYN_PORT=4000